
在MyBatis中使用小于等于转义字符是一个常见的需求,在实际开发过程中经常会遇到这样的情况。下面我们将详细介绍如何在MyBatis中使用小于等于转义字符,并提供具体的代码示例。
首先,我们需要明确小于等于转义字符在SQL语句中的表示方式。在SQL语句中,小于等于操作符通常以“
接下来,让我们通过一个示例来演示如何在MyBatis中使用小于等于转义字符。假设我们有一个User表,包含id、username和age字段,现在我们要查询年龄小于等于25岁的用户。我们可以按照以下步骤来实现:
本文档主要讲述的是Android数据格式解析对象JSON用法;JSON可以将Java对象转成json格式的字符串,可以将json字符串转换成Java。比XML更轻量级,Json使用起来比较轻便和简单。JSON数据格式,在Android中被广泛运用于客户端和服务器通信,在网络数据传输与解析时非常方便。希望本文档会给有需要的朋友带来帮助;感兴趣的朋友可以过来看看
- 首先,定义一个User类来映射数据库表的字段:
public class User {
private Long id;
private String username;
private Integer age;
// 省略getter和setter方法
}- 在Mapper.xml文件中编写查询语句,使用小于等于操作符:
- 在对应的Mapper接口中定义方法,并提供查询条件参数:
public interface UserMapper {
List selectUserByAge(@Param("age") Integer age);
} - 调用Mapper接口的方法,传入小于等于条件参数进行查询:
public class MyBatisTest {
public static void main(String[] args) {
SqlSession sqlSession = MyBatisUtil.getSqlSession();
UserMapper userMapper = sqlSession.getMapper(UserMapper.class);
List users = userMapper.selectUserByAge(25);
for (User user : users) {
System.out.println(user.getUsername() + "," + user.getAge() + "岁");
}
sqlSession.close();
}
} 通过以上步骤,我们就成功实现了在MyBatis中使用小于等于转义字符的查询操作。在实际开发中,我们可以根据具体业务需求和条件来灵活运用小于等于操作符,实现更加个性化的数据查询。
总结:在MyBatis中使用小于等于转义字符是一种常见的数据库操作需求,通过合理编写SQL语句和对应的Mapper方法,我们可以方便地实现该功能。在开发过程中,我们需要注意传递参数的正确性和安全性,以确保程序的稳定和可靠性。希望以上内容能够帮助您更好地理解和运用小于等于转义字符在MyBatis中的应用。









